BASIC PURPOSE Serves as a trusted, strategic advisor to Area Staff, the local management teams, and drives field execution to support business objectives consistent with organization values. Ensures alignment of HR strategy with business objectives. Serves as the primary HR liaison for the Area Staff, the HR team and the local management teams on matters affecting the area. Consults with Region and Functional Partners to optimize effectiveness, team cohesiveness, and ensure effective business decision making particularly related to the human assets of the business. Conducts Area Employee Relations needs analysis and matches HR solutions to identified gaps. Serves as the area escalation point on employee relations issues of significant complexity.
This position is onsite overseeing Fife and Everett Washington distribution centers and requires 50% travel.

The Region Senior Buyer, Commodity utilizes category expertise and vendor specific knowledge to determine procurement and inventory management strategies for multiple warehouse locations across a Region. Acts as a subject matter expert and mentor for the buying function and are an integral member of the team that works on system and process enhancements across functions within the business unit. This role will execute business recovery strategy and will make key decisions as needed to support sales growth, profitability and helping our company become the undisputed best.
This role will report to the Region Director, Commodity and work in conjunction with the region/area merchandising team, revenue management team, Region Commodity Procurement Manager and Area Director of Replenishment.

***** Registering to the FMCSA Clearinghouse is a requirement by the Department of Transportation. All Drivers are required to the Clearinghouse website and register to the new database. The Clearinghouse is a secure online database that provides real-time information about commercial driver's license (CDL) and commercial learner's permit (CLP) holders' drug and alcohol program violations.
